Frequently asked questions
Are these suitable for deep surgical access?
Yes, these scissors are specifically designed with an 11-inch length and a long handle, which provide the necessary reach and control for accessing deeper anatomical areas during surgery.
Is high-grade stainless steel used for durability?
Absolutely. These instruments are manufactured from high-quality, durable stainless steel, ensuring they are robust enough to withstand the rigors of repeated sterilization and daily surgical performance.
Do these scissors feature safe blunt tips?
Yes, they feature a Blunt/Blunt (B/B) tip configuration. This design prioritizes safety during use, making them excellent for delicate dissection and careful separation of tissues.
Are these safe for latex-sensitive patients?
Yes, these scissors are not made with natural rubber latex, making them a safe and suitable choice for facilities that require strictly latex-free surgical instrumentation.
Are these instruments TAA compliant?
Yes, the Sklar Willauer Scissors are TAA compliant, meeting the regulatory requirements for use in federal and government-contracted surgical settings.
Are these ideal for cardiothoracic procedures?
They are specifically engineered for cardiothoracic surgery. Their design—which includes non-ratcheted finger rings—provides the precise control required for the complex dissection tasks often found in these procedures.
Can these be reused after sterilization?
Yes, they are intended to be a reusable surgical instrument. Their construction is designed to withstand standard, repetitive sterilization protocols for long-term use in your surgical practice.
Do they provide a probe-like action?
Yes, the unique curvature of the jaws is specifically designed to facilitate a probe-like action. This allows surgeons to achieve precise manipulation during dissection in deep surgical fields.
Do the finger rings ensure a secure grip?
Yes, the finger ring handle style is a classic feature that offers a secure and reliable grip, providing the consistent, tactile feedback surgeons need during non-ratcheted dissecting tasks.
Are these supplied in sterile packaging?
These instruments are supplied non-sterile. This allows your facility the flexibility to incorporate them directly into your existing, established sterilization workflows for reusable tools.
